The Singapore Industrial & Construction Landscape

Singapore’s building sector is driven by strict regulatory environments focused on sustainability, structural safety, and high-efficiency prefabrication. With the Building and Construction Authority (BCA) continuously updating the BCA Green Mark 2021 framework, the demand for high-performance thermal envelopes has surged. Sandwich panels are now critical components in reducing the Envelope Thermal Transfer Value (ETTV) for commercial buildings and the Overall Thermal Transfer Value (OTTV) for industrial properties.

Furthermore, Singapore’s land constraints dictate that industrial development scales vertically. Modern ramp-up warehouses, high-specification manufacturing facilities in Tuas, and advanced data centers in Changi require lightweight cladding solutions that offer high structural integrity, rapid assembly capability, and superior fire resistance certificates issued by the Singapore Civil Defence Force (SCDF).

Material Science & Engineering for Singapore's Safety Standards

Building safety in Singapore is non-negotiable. The SCDF maintains strict oversight of materials utilized for internal partitions, external cladding, and ceiling systems. As a premium manufacturer, our sandwich panels undergo rigorous testing according to British Standards (BS 476 Parts 6 & 7) and European Standards (EN 13501-1) to ensure structural integrity and flame-retardant safety.

Polyisocyanurate (PIR) Core

PIR represents the gold standard for cold chain, food processing units, and high-tech cleanrooms in Singapore. With exceptional thermal resistance, it creates an advanced carbon char barrier upon flame contact, dramatically reducing flame spread and smoke emission.

High-Density Rockwool Core

For applications demanding strict fire ratings (up to 4 hours), our high-density rockwool core panels offer absolute peace of mind. Non-combustible, sound-dampening, and highly breathable, they are ideal for industrial power plants, heavy machinery halls, and complex partition setups.

Corrosion Resistant Coatings

Given Singapore's high relative humidity and salt-laden sea air, we offer hot-dip galvanized steel skins coated with PVDF or Polyvinylidene Fluoride. This ensures long-term paint adhesion, UV resistance, and protection against chemical washdowns in sterile cleanrooms.

The Physics of Thermal Insulation: R-Values & Energy Conservation

When selecting architectural panels, understanding thermal metrics is essential. The U-value (thermal transmittance) of an insulated panel determines how much heat enters the air-conditioned spaces. By manufacturing sandwich panels with customized core thicknesses ranging from 50mm to 200mm, we can achieve low U-values down to 0.11 W/m²K. For a typical warehouse structure in Jurong, this reduces mechanical ventilation and cooling costs by up to 35%, ensuring rapid ROI and contributing to national carbon neutrality goals.

Localized Application Scenarios in Singapore

Due to space constraints and specific municipal planning rules in Singapore, modular panel systems must serve highly versatile roles. Below are primary use cases where our technical products excel:

Industrial Cleanrooms & Laboratories

Operating in the high-tech Biopolis, One-North, or Tuas Biomedical Parks requires micro-environments with absolute control over temperature, dust particles, and relative humidity. Our double-sided flat steel sandwich panels with specialized anti-static finishes prevent microscopic dust gathering, ensuring compliance with local ISO-14644 cleanroom clean standards.

Cold Chain Logistics & Cold Storage

With Singapore positioning itself as a premier regional transshipment hub for pharmaceuticals and perishables, cooling efficiency is paramount. PIR insulated panels are designed to perform reliably at sub-zero temperatures (ranging down to -40°C) with tight tongue-and-groove joints that prevent thermal bridging and ice buildup.

Commercial Office Complexes & Temp Site Offices

LTA, HDB, and PUB infrastructural project sites require flexible, modular offices that can be rapidly relocated. Utilizing our flat-pack and glass-clad office containers equipped with rockwool sandwich wall panels, construction partners establish safe, comfortable, and air-conditioned operational hubs under the tropical heat.

Do your sandwich panels comply with the SCDF (Singapore Civil Defence Force) Fire Safety Code?
Yes, our panels are engineered to meet Singapore Fire Code requirements. Depending on the core selection (such as high-density mineral Rockwool or customized Polyisocyanurate - PIR), our panel assemblies achieve Class 0 (BS 476 Part 6 & 7) performance for surface spread of flame. We provide certified technical datasheets and testing documentation to facilitate your Professional Engineer (PE) submissions and SCDF Certificate of Conformity (CoC) applications.
How do you optimize your sandwich panel joints for Singapore's monsoon rainfall and humidity?
Our panels incorporate advanced continuous interlocking joints featuring integrated factory-applied sealing gaskets. For coastal industrial installations in Singapore (e.g., Tuas, Jurong Island), this system ensures absolute weather-tightness against driving rain, prevents capillary action, and seals against moisture ingress, avoiding premature core delamination and structural rust.
Can these panel structures contribute to BCA Green Mark certification points?
Absolutely. By using our high R-value PIR sandwich panels, projects can significantly lower the thermal transmission coefficient (U-value) of the external building envelope. This reduces overall cooling energy demand, directly translating into energy-efficiency points under the BCA Green Mark framework for commercial and industrial structures.

What anti-corrosion grades are available for maritime environments?
For coastal zones, we offer galvanized steel skins with pre-painted PVDF (Fluorocarbon) coatings or high-durability polyester (HDP) finishes with structural ratings up to AZ150. These coatings offer superior UV block resistance and resist rust or chemical degradation even under high salinity.
